About Sycamore Hills, MO

Sycamore Hills is a small community located in Missouri with a population of 612 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$87,581 per year, which is 17% above the national median of $75,149. The median age of 49.3 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.

Housing Market Overview

The housing market in Sycamore Hills features a median home value of $125,600, which is 49% below the national median of $244,900. This makes Sycamore Hills one of the more affordable markets in the country, potentially attractive for first-time homebuyers. Median monthly rent is $1,112, 4% below the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 339 total housing units, 72% are owner-occupied (240 units) and 28% are renter-occupied (94 units). The high homeownership rate suggests a stable, established residential community.

Economy & Employment

The local economy in Sycamore Hills shows an unemployment rate of 0.0%, which is lower than the national rate of 3.7%, indicating a relatively strong job market. The poverty rate stands at 7.1%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Sycamore Hills have an average one-way commute time of 24.6 minutes.
